Wired network settings

If [Wired Network] is selected in [Active] on the [Network] screen, configure the settings for a wired network connection.
Click [Wired Network] of [Network] in the Settings menu of the [Settings] screen
1.
34).
The Wired Network Settings screen appears.
Configure the following settings.

Set ON or OFF for DHCP.
Click [TEST] to perform a communication check.
When this is set to [ON], clicking [OFF] applies the static IP
address setting.
Displays the MAC address.
Displays the IP address.
Displays the following status information.
Link up: Displayed when communication is possible.
Link down: Displayed when communication is not possible.
Retrieving an IP address from DHCP: Displayed when
getting the IP address from DHCP.
Set the IP address.
This can be set when [DHCP] is set to [OFF].
Set the subnet mask.
This can be set when [DHCP] is set to [OFF].
Set the default gateway.
This can be set when [DHCP] is set to [OFF].
